How to create modular environment authoring tools enabling artists to assemble rich levels from reusable pieces.
A practical blueprint for building modular authoring pipelines where artists combine reusable assets, rules, and metadata to craft expansive, cohesive game environments without bespoke scripting every time.
August 12, 2025
Facebook X Reddit
Modular environment authoring begins with a clear separation between content and behavior. Teams that succeed in this space design reusable pieces that can be combined in countless ways, while preserving scene integrity. Artists benefit from standardized interfaces, predictable asset lifecycles, and consistent metadata. Engineers gain from decoupled systems that support parallel work streams and faster iteration. The core idea is to treat levels as a composition problem, not a code problem. By establishing a shared vocabulary for pieces, connectors, and constraints, you enable scalable collaboration. The result is safer asset reuse, fewer surprises at integration, and a smoother path from concept to playable space.
Modular environment authoring begins with a clear separation between content and behavior. Teams that succeed in this space design reusable pieces that can be combined in countless ways, while preserving scene integrity. Artists benefit from standardized interfaces, predictable asset lifecycles, and consistent metadata. Engineers gain from decoupled systems that support parallel work streams and faster iteration. The core idea is to treat levels as a composition problem, not a code problem. By establishing a shared vocabulary for pieces, connectors, and constraints, you enable scalable collaboration. The result is safer asset reuse, fewer surprises at integration, and a smoother path from concept to playable space.
At the heart of modular toolchains lies a robust asset taxonomy. Begin by categorizing pieces into tiles, props, macro blocks, and environmental effects. Attach lightweight metadata that describes scale, snapping points, collision boundaries, material prompts, and LOD transitions. The metadata should be machine-readable to empower editors to automatically validate arrangements before users commit changes. A well-defined taxonomy minimizes duplication and conflicts when artists blend pieces from different teams. It also supports automated tooling later, such as procedural placement, variation galleries, and export pipelines. As taxonomy solidifies, the editor can present meaningful suggestions rather than raw asset lists.
At the heart of modular toolchains lies a robust asset taxonomy. Begin by categorizing pieces into tiles, props, macro blocks, and environmental effects. Attach lightweight metadata that describes scale, snapping points, collision boundaries, material prompts, and LOD transitions. The metadata should be machine-readable to empower editors to automatically validate arrangements before users commit changes. A well-defined taxonomy minimizes duplication and conflicts when artists blend pieces from different teams. It also supports automated tooling later, such as procedural placement, variation galleries, and export pipelines. As taxonomy solidifies, the editor can present meaningful suggestions rather than raw asset lists.
Designing performance-aware editors that stay responsive under load
A successful interface for modular environments emphasizes discoverability, context, and feedback. Visual browsing becomes the primary language, with thumbnails, miniatures, and dynamic previews that reflect real-time lighting and material states. Editors should offer drag-and-drop assembly, snapping rules, and reversible actions so artists feel in control. Keyboard shortcuts speed their work, while inline documentation reduces cognitive load. To prevent accidental breaks, implement non-destructive editing and quick rollback capabilities. Crucially, provide a live validation pane that flags missing references, incompatible scales, or conflicting material instructions. When artists trust the editor, creativity flourishes without fear of breaking the scene.
A successful interface for modular environments emphasizes discoverability, context, and feedback. Visual browsing becomes the primary language, with thumbnails, miniatures, and dynamic previews that reflect real-time lighting and material states. Editors should offer drag-and-drop assembly, snapping rules, and reversible actions so artists feel in control. Keyboard shortcuts speed their work, while inline documentation reduces cognitive load. To prevent accidental breaks, implement non-destructive editing and quick rollback capabilities. Crucially, provide a live validation pane that flags missing references, incompatible scales, or conflicting material instructions. When artists trust the editor, creativity flourishes without fear of breaking the scene.
ADVERTISEMENT
ADVERTISEMENT
Beyond the interface, performance is a maker-or-breaker for large environments. Modular systems demand efficient loading, streaming, and culling strategies. Use instance-based rendering where possible, and reserve explicit instancing for repeated pieces to minimize draw calls. Employ a hierarchical scene graph that supports both coarse placement and fine-tuned adjustments without reprocessing distant assets. Build a lightweight sandbox for test environments that mirrors production constraints, so artists can experiment safely. Consider asynchronous pipelines for asset assembly and validation, ensuring the editor remains responsive during heavy operations. A responsive tool is a powerful catalyst for ambitious world-building.
Beyond the interface, performance is a maker-or-breaker for large environments. Modular systems demand efficient loading, streaming, and culling strategies. Use instance-based rendering where possible, and reserve explicit instancing for repeated pieces to minimize draw calls. Employ a hierarchical scene graph that supports both coarse placement and fine-tuned adjustments without reprocessing distant assets. Build a lightweight sandbox for test environments that mirrors production constraints, so artists can experiment safely. Consider asynchronous pipelines for asset assembly and validation, ensuring the editor remains responsive during heavy operations. A responsive tool is a powerful catalyst for ambitious world-building.
Balancing artistic freedom with technical constraints and governance
Interoperability unlocks true modularity. Design editors to consume assets from common feeds and export to multiple engines or runtime environments. By adopting open formats and stable APIs, you reduce the friction of moving work across studios and platforms. Expose extension points that allow artists to introduce custom widgets, palette packs, or procedural variants without requiring core changes. Document versioning and compatibility rules so teams can evolve their pipelines without breaking old content. A future-proof approach also anticipates data governance: provenance tracking, asset licensing, and change history should be accessible and transparent. The payoff is long-term resilience and smoother onboarding.
Interoperability unlocks true modularity. Design editors to consume assets from common feeds and export to multiple engines or runtime environments. By adopting open formats and stable APIs, you reduce the friction of moving work across studios and platforms. Expose extension points that allow artists to introduce custom widgets, palette packs, or procedural variants without requiring core changes. Document versioning and compatibility rules so teams can evolve their pipelines without breaking old content. A future-proof approach also anticipates data governance: provenance tracking, asset licensing, and change history should be accessible and transparent. The payoff is long-term resilience and smoother onboarding.
ADVERTISEMENT
ADVERTISEMENT
Collaborative workflows hinge on disciplined sequencing and clear ownership. Define roles such as space designer, texture curator, lighting lead, and performance steward, each with explicit responsibilities and acceptance criteria. Implement review gates that focus on artistic intent while filtering out technical regressions. Enable parallel streams where artists contribute disjoint sections, then automatically assemble into a cohesive whole. Version control for scenes, not just assets, helps teams audit decisions and revert if a creative direction falters. Strong collaboration reduces bottlenecks and accelerates creativity by keeping teams aligned on goals and constraints.
Collaborative workflows hinge on disciplined sequencing and clear ownership. Define roles such as space designer, texture curator, lighting lead, and performance steward, each with explicit responsibilities and acceptance criteria. Implement review gates that focus on artistic intent while filtering out technical regressions. Enable parallel streams where artists contribute disjoint sections, then automatically assemble into a cohesive whole. Version control for scenes, not just assets, helps teams audit decisions and revert if a creative direction falters. Strong collaboration reduces bottlenecks and accelerates creativity by keeping teams aligned on goals and constraints.
Enabling rapid iteration cycles through prototyping and validation
Reuse thrives when constraints feel natural rather than punitive. Establish a library of modular blocks with defined usage rules, such as maximum polycount per block, consistent UV layouts, and aligned lighting templates. When space designers know the limits, they can push creativity within safe boundaries. Encourage variations that honor the source material while delivering fresh experiences. Provide example configurations or “recipes” that demonstrate how different blocks combine to achieve distinct atmospheres. This approach guards performance and style coherence while still empowering artists to experiment. The result is engaging, performant worlds with recognizable identity.
Reuse thrives when constraints feel natural rather than punitive. Establish a library of modular blocks with defined usage rules, such as maximum polycount per block, consistent UV layouts, and aligned lighting templates. When space designers know the limits, they can push creativity within safe boundaries. Encourage variations that honor the source material while delivering fresh experiences. Provide example configurations or “recipes” that demonstrate how different blocks combine to achieve distinct atmospheres. This approach guards performance and style coherence while still empowering artists to experiment. The result is engaging, performant worlds with recognizable identity.
Governance should be lightweight yet effective. Automate checks for asset integrity, compatibility with current scenes, and adherence to style guidelines. Provide dashboards that summarize scene health, flagged issues, and time-to-fix metrics for rapid triage. A strong governance layer helps teams scale without letting quality slip. It should not feel punitive; instead, it should guide creators toward best practices. By blending automation with human judgment, you balance consistency with experimentation. The most enduring environments emerge when governance supports experimentation rather than stifling it.
Governance should be lightweight yet effective. Automate checks for asset integrity, compatibility with current scenes, and adherence to style guidelines. Provide dashboards that summarize scene health, flagged issues, and time-to-fix metrics for rapid triage. A strong governance layer helps teams scale without letting quality slip. It should not feel punitive; instead, it should guide creators toward best practices. By blending automation with human judgment, you balance consistency with experimentation. The most enduring environments emerge when governance supports experimentation rather than stifling it.
ADVERTISEMENT
ADVERTISEMENT
Long-term strategies for maintainable, scalable modular toolchains
Prototyping is where ideas crystallize. Build a dedicated prototype mode within the editor that lets artists assemble a rough composition from a curated subset of blocks, then quickly test in-engine. The prototype should ignore some production constraints but still provide credible feedback on placement, scale, and lighting. Use mock assets to decouple visual fidelity from layout decisions, allowing rapid iteration without heavy asset pipelines. This separation accelerates iterations while preserving a clear path toward final polish. A strong prototype workflow shortens the distance between concept and a demonstrable playable space.
Prototyping is where ideas crystallize. Build a dedicated prototype mode within the editor that lets artists assemble a rough composition from a curated subset of blocks, then quickly test in-engine. The prototype should ignore some production constraints but still provide credible feedback on placement, scale, and lighting. Use mock assets to decouple visual fidelity from layout decisions, allowing rapid iteration without heavy asset pipelines. This separation accelerates iterations while preserving a clear path toward final polish. A strong prototype workflow shortens the distance between concept and a demonstrable playable space.
Validation mechanisms provide safety nets during iteration. Implement automated tests that verify that each assembly passes collision, navmesh, and pathfinding checks, as well as accessibility considerations such as lighting evenly distributed across key story zones. Early alerts help prevent downstream rework. Visualization tools that highlight problematic zones, mismatched scales, or inconsistent material properties guide artists toward precise corrections. When feedback is fast and precise, teams avoid repeated cycles of guesswork and rework. The editor becomes a trusted partner in shaping the player experience.
Validation mechanisms provide safety nets during iteration. Implement automated tests that verify that each assembly passes collision, navmesh, and pathfinding checks, as well as accessibility considerations such as lighting evenly distributed across key story zones. Early alerts help prevent downstream rework. Visualization tools that highlight problematic zones, mismatched scales, or inconsistent material properties guide artists toward precise corrections. When feedback is fast and precise, teams avoid repeated cycles of guesswork and rework. The editor becomes a trusted partner in shaping the player experience.
Maintainability hinges on clear documentation and predictable upgrade paths. Create living guides that describe how blocks are constructed, how to extend them, and how they interact with other systems. Versioned blocks and deprecation schedules prevent sudden breaks as engines evolve. Encourage community contributions within a structured framework that emphasizes readability and testability. Regularly review dependencies to minimize coupling and maximize reuse. A well-documented toolchain reduces knowledge silos, enabling new team members to contribute quickly and confidently. Long-term stability emerges when every component has a clear purpose, traceable lineage, and robust rollback options.
Maintainability hinges on clear documentation and predictable upgrade paths. Create living guides that describe how blocks are constructed, how to extend them, and how they interact with other systems. Versioned blocks and deprecation schedules prevent sudden breaks as engines evolve. Encourage community contributions within a structured framework that emphasizes readability and testability. Regularly review dependencies to minimize coupling and maximize reuse. A well-documented toolchain reduces knowledge silos, enabling new team members to contribute quickly and confidently. Long-term stability emerges when every component has a clear purpose, traceable lineage, and robust rollback options.
Looking ahead, modular environment authoring should embrace AI-assisted composition, procedural variation, and cross-team collaboration, all while preserving artist agency. AI can suggest compatible piece mixes, lighting presets, and material transitions, but final decisions remain in human hands. Procedural variation enables a library to produce countless distinct scenes from a base set, ensuring freshness at scale. Cross-team collaboration is sustained by shared standards, transparent pipelines, and mutual accountability. The enduring lesson is that modular tools amplify creativity when designed for humans first, with engineering rigor backing every creative decision.
Looking ahead, modular environment authoring should embrace AI-assisted composition, procedural variation, and cross-team collaboration, all while preserving artist agency. AI can suggest compatible piece mixes, lighting presets, and material transitions, but final decisions remain in human hands. Procedural variation enables a library to produce countless distinct scenes from a base set, ensuring freshness at scale. Cross-team collaboration is sustained by shared standards, transparent pipelines, and mutual accountability. The enduring lesson is that modular tools amplify creativity when designed for humans first, with engineering rigor backing every creative decision.
Related Articles
This evergreen guide outlines practical strategies for building physics simulations that stay functional, accurate, and responsive under limited compute, power, or memory, ensuring consistent gameplay experiences across devices and scenarios.
August 07, 2025
Procedural foliage must feel alive by responding to wind, weight, collisions, and player touch, while maintaining performance, artistic intent, and believable growth patterns across varied environments and gameplay scenarios.
Designing robust editor validation suites prevents costly integration issues by catching common content problems early, guiding artists and developers toward consistent, clean assets and reliable builds across platforms.
Designing robust authority transfer in multiplayer systems demands a clear protocol, predictable ownership rules, latency-aware decisions, and resilient conflict resolution that scales gracefully across diverse network conditions while preserving game consistency.
Designing plugin ecosystems that invite robust community participation demands a precise balance of security, extensibility, and governance, ensuring creativity flourishes while the core engine remains stable, safe, and maintainable for everyone involved.
This evergreen article examines how developers reconcile high visual fidelity with smooth performance, across diverse devices, by tailoring assets, pipelines, and platform-specific optimizations while preserving artistic intent and player immersion.
This article explores robust approaches to building procedural animation controllers that respond to physics impulses in real time, ensuring believable motion, stability, and artistic control across diverse gameplay scenarios.
Crafting physics puzzles that stay solvable and fair requires balancing realistic simulation, adaptable constraints, and considerate feedback, ensuring players of all styles can explore solutions without frustration or guesswork.
August 04, 2025
Predictive aim assist systems must balance responsiveness with fairness, adapting to varied controller peripherals, playstyles, and latency environments to preserve skill expression, reduce frustration, and maintain competitive integrity across diverse player bases.
A thoughtful in-game economy balances player motivation, fairness, and sustainability by rewarding meaningful engagement, discouraging loopholes, and aligning monetization with long-term player satisfaction and community health.
This evergreen guide explains how to design build artifacts and distribution pipelines so teams can rollback safely while gathering analytics, telemetry, and quality signals throughout every release cycle.
This evergreen guide explores robust architectural patterns that separate core gameplay decisions from rendering concerns, empowering tools, editors, and scripted pipelines to operate without destabilizing the runtime, while preserving performance, testability, and scalability across evolving engines.
Dynamic difficulty systems adapt to player skill and pacing, balancing challenge with accessibility, learning, and long-term engagement. This evergreen guide explores frameworks, data signals, tuning approaches, and practical considerations for thoughtful design across genres and platforms.
Effective patch orchestration balances feature delivery with preserving player continuity, ensuring seamless transitions, informed testing, and clear communication that keeps communities engaged while minimizing disruption across platforms and services.
August 08, 2025
Effective memory leak detection in large game projects requires a structured plan, practical tooling, deterministic reproduction steps, and disciplined triage. This guide shares proven approaches for developers seeking reliable, long-term stability.
This evergreen guide explains how developers implement deterministic replays, ensuring reproducibility across sessions, platforms, and hardware, and outlines best practices for pinpointing issues with precision and efficiency.
August 03, 2025
Blending animation in real-time games requires balancing fluid motion with immediate responsiveness, ensuring transitions feel natural, preserving character intent, and maintaining performance across diverse hardware without sacrificing player immersion or control fidelity.
Designing resilient rollback procedures for game content updates requires meticulous versioning, automated testing, safe data handling, and clear rollback triggers to protect players, studios, and ongoing live operations from disruption.
August 07, 2025
Building a scalable logging system for game engines demands thoughtful design, robust instrumentation, and disciplined postmortem workflows that translate raw events into actionable insights across teams and platforms.
A practical, multi-layered approach to testing cross-platform builds that anticipates, detects, and fixes platform-specific bugs, ensuring consistent performance, visuals, and user experience across consoles, PCs, and mobile devices.